#7821d5 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7821d5 is composed of 47.1% red, 12.9%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.7% cyan, 84.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 269 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 48.2%. #7821d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#f042ff with #0000ab.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

● #7821d5 color description : Strong violet.
The hexadecimal color #7821d5 has RGB values of R:120, G:33,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 7872981.
